Where to Be Careful

While Addition Wheels 11 - 20 is versatile, there are some limitations. For instance, the design may not work well on small hoop sizes. If you’re planning to stitch it on a cap or a hat, you’ll need to consider how the design will wrap around the curved surface. The same applies to textured fabrics or thin materials where the stitches might not lay flat.

On dark fabrics, the design’s vibrancy might be lost unless you use a high-contrast thread color. This is especially important if you're creating a finished product for sale, as the visual appeal directly affects customer perception. Similarly, on stretchy or delicate fabrics, you’ll need to use the right stabilizer to prevent puckering or distortion.

For commercial embroidery projects, it’s worth testing the design on different fabric types before committing to a large batch. The stitch density is moderate, which is good for most applications, but dense areas might require additional support to avoid fraying or uneven stitching.
